The cheapest way to get from Preston to Heswall is to bus and train which costs £7 - £14 and takes 2h 58m.
The fastest way to get from Preston to Heswall is to drive which takes 1h 10m and costs £9 - £14.
No, there is no direct bus from Preston station to Heswall station. However, there are services departing from Railway Station and arriving at Heswall Bus Station via Union Street and Whitechapel.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 9m.
The distance between Preston and Heswall is 82 miles. The road distance is 39.2 miles.
The best way to get from Preston to Heswall without a car is to train and bus which takes 1h 51m and costs £9 - £35.
It takes approximately 1h 51m to get from Preston to Heswall, including transfers.
Preston to Heswall bus services, operated by Stagecoach Cumbria & North Lancashire, depart from Railway Station.
Preston to Heswall bus services, operated by Stagecoach Cumbria & North Lancashire, arrive at Union Street station.
Yes, the driving distance between Preston to Heswall is 39 miles. It takes approximately 1h 10m to drive from Preston to Heswall.
